Publisher's Synopsis

This volume presents a guide to help commissioning engineers and maintenance contractors select appropriate test methods to set correct minimum outdoor air rates, and is intended for use in setting minimum outdoor air rates in mechanical ventilation systems that use modulating dampers to vary the proportion of outdoor air between a fixed minimum and full outdoor air. It also provides useful background information on the importance of ensuring that minimum outdoor air is correctly set, when tests should be performed and the type of problems which can occur. The guidance was produced from the results of 18 sets of tests of different airflow rate measurement methods. The tests were applied to 14 ventilation systems supplying a range of building types, including a library, lecture theatre, function suite, swimming pool and several offices.
